The Dehydrating Process: A Step-by-Step Guide

Selecting the Right Bananas:

  • Choose ripe, yet firm bananas for the best flavor and texture.

Preparing for Dehydration:

  • Slice bananas uniformly for even drying.
  • To prevent browning, consider a lemon juice dip.

The Dehydrating Process:

  • Arrange slices on dehydrator trays, ensuring they don’t touch.
  • Set your dehydrator to 135°F (52°C), as recommended on Fresh Off The Grid.
  • Dehydrate for 6-12 hours, checking for that perfect leathery texture.

Storage and Shelf Life

Storing Correctly:

  • Keep in airtight containers in a cool, dark place.
  • Proper storage extends shelf life significantly.

Shelf Life Insights:

  • When stored correctly, they can last for several months.
